1. The Typical Male Anatomy (Standard Type)
Overview
The most common representation of male genital anatomy aligns with what is often
depicted in textbooks and media: a penis with a glans (head), shaft, and testicles housed
within the scrotum. This "standard" type serves as the baseline for understanding
variations.
Structural Features
- Penis: Usually cylindrical, with an average erect length of about 13-15 cm (5-6 inches).
The glans is typically rounded and more sensitive. - Foreskin: Present in uncircumcised
males, covering the glans partially or fully at rest. - Testicles: Two oval-shaped glands,
approximately 4-5 cm in length, producing sperm and testosterone. - Scrotum: The pouch
that contains the testicles, capable of temperature regulation.
Functional Aspects
- Adequate erectile function. - Sperm production within the testicles. - Normal urinary
function through the urethra. ---

4. The Penile Curvature Type (Peyronie’s Disease or Congenital
Curvature)
Overview
This type involves a noticeable curvature of the erect penis, which can be congenital or
acquired (most commonly due to Peyronie’s disease).
Structural Features
- Curvature varies from subtle to severe. - Usually localized to one side, often due to
fibrous plaque formation or developmental factors.
Functional Implications
- May cause pain during erection. - Can interfere with sexual intercourse. - Psychological
distress is common.
Management Strategies
- Medical therapies including medications. - Penile traction therapy. - Surgical correction in
severe cases. ---

7. The Chordee or Penile Torsion Type
Overview
Chordee involves a ventral (downward) curvature of the penis, often associated with
hypospadias or congenital anomalies.
Structural Features
- Abnormal bend or twist along the shaft. - May be mild or severe, affecting appearance
and function.
Nine Male Anatomy Types
9
Functional Impacts
- Possible difficulty with penetration. - Pain during erection or intercourse.
Treatment Options
- Surgical correction is common. - Postoperative therapy may be necessary for optimal
outcomes. ---
